McLaughlin discusses his undergraduate years in the Dartmouth College Class of 1954, his service as a trustee, and his presidency of the college from 1981 to 1987. Some of the topics he covers include his friendship with John Sloan Dickey, his assessment of John Kemeny, governance of the college, his relationship with the faculty, the medical center move to Lebanon, the reinstatement of ROTC, the occupation of Parkhurst Hall, and the shanties on the college green in protest of the college's investments in South Africa.
